Frequently Asked Questions about hostels in Cromwell

  • What are the most affordable attractions for backpackers to visit in and around Cromwell?

    Cromwell's got some great budget-friendly options for backpackers. The Cromwell Museum is a must-see for understanding the town's history. For stunning views, head to the top of the Pisa Range, and if you're into cycling, the Otago Central Rail Trail is a classic. You can also visit the Kawarau Gorge Suspension Bridge for a bit of adventure.

  • What should every traveler visit at least once in and around Cromwell?

    The highlight for many is the historic Old Cromwell Town, which showcases the town's early gold-mining days. You can't miss the iconic Kawarau Gorge, where you can try bungy jumping or white water rafting. If you're looking for something unique, take a trip to the Gibbston Valley, known for its vineyards and wineries.

  • How can travelers reach Cromwell, and what transportation options are available?

    Cromwell is easily accessible by car, and you can rent one at Queenstown Airport. There are regular buses from Queenstown and Dunedin, which take about an hour and a half. If you're feeling adventurous, you can also take a scenic flight from Queenstown.

  • What other towns should you visit near Cromwell?

    Queenstown is the closest town to Cromwell, known for its adventure activities and nightlife. You can also visit Wanaka, a charming town on the shores of Lake Wanaka, famous for its stunning scenery and relaxed atmosphere.
